Walker & Dunlop (WD): Evaluating Valuation in Light of Consistent Revenue and Profit Growth
Walker & Dunlop (WD) just published its third quarter earnings, revealing higher revenue and net income compared to last year. This steady improvement across both the recent quarter and year-to-date period is drawing investor attention.
See our latest analysis for Walker & Dunlop.
Walker & Dunlop’s third quarter earnings may be encouraging, but the latest momentum in its share price tells a different story. Despite recent growth in revenue and profits, the company’s share price has dropped sharply, down nearly 25% over the past month, and total shareholder return sits at -39% for the past year. This suggests that while fundamentals are improving, investors remain cautious as market sentiment continues to recalibrate.

Most Popular Narrative: 32.6% Undervalued
Walker & Dunlop's most followed narrative values the stock at $92.50, well above its last close of $62.32. This significant gap sets an optimistic fair value and provides context for the underlying growth story that analysts see emerging for the company.
Investments in technology platforms (small balance lending, appraisal, Galaxy, Client Navigator) are resulting in higher client acquisition (17% of YTD volume from new clients), increased operational efficiency, and improved margins, suggesting longer-term enhancement of net margins and top-line growth.
What is underpinning this bullish valuation? Analysts are relying on a potential increase in profits along with improved margins, all driven by investments in technology and expansion into new markets. Another View: Multiples Raise Caution
While analysts project solid upside by valuing Walker & Dunlop on optimistic earnings growth, our comparison based on the price-to-earnings ratio paints a less rosy picture. The company trades at 18.9x earnings, which is much higher than peers (8.4x) and above the industry average (13.1x), also exceeding its fair ratio of 17.4x. This premium means the market may be expecting more than what fundamentals currently deliver, increasing the risk that expectations could be disappointed down the line.
